排序
CentOS GCC編譯器如何生成優化代碼
在centos系統上,利用gcc編譯器優化代碼,可通過以下方法實現: 一、 編譯命令及優化等級 GCC提供多種優化選項,例如-O1、-O2、-O3和-Os,分別對應不同優化級別。 基礎編譯命令: gcc -o myprog...
java是基于c語言嗎 Java與C語言的底層關系探討
java不是直接基于c語言開發的,但受到了c語言的影響。1.java的語法結構與c語言相似,易于上手。2.java是解釋型語言,依賴jvm執行,具有平臺無關性。3.c語言是編譯型語言,直接生成機器碼,性能...
getconf命令在Debian中的兼容性如何
getconf命令在Debian以及其衍生版本(像Ubuntu)里一般自帶,它用來獲取系統的配置參數。通常來說,getconf在Debian系統里運行沒有問題,不過還是有一些特殊情況需要注意。 命令的基礎使用 getc...
win32是什么意思?
Win32是指“Microsoft Windows”操作系統的32位環境,與Win64都為Windows常見環境。如今的Win32操作系統可以一邊聽音樂,一邊編程,一邊打印文檔;Win32操作系統是一個典型的多線程操作系統。 W...
Linux下使用GCC進行嵌入式ARM匯編優化的常見配置方法
linux下使用gcc進行嵌入式arm匯編優化的常見配置方法 引言:嵌入式系統中,對于ARM架構的處理器,往往需要進行高效的優化,以滿足實時性能和資源限制。而匯編語言是一種可以直接控制硬件的語言...
linux系統和win系統有什么區別?
Linux和Windows是兩種不同的操作系統,主要區別在于:內核架構:Linux基于Unix,開源,而Windows基于專有內核。許可證:Linux大多開源,而Windows專有。命令行界面:Linux以CLI為主,Windows以G...
深度解析Linux中關于操作系統的知識點
操作系統概述與核心概念 計算機系統中包含一個基本的程序集合,稱為操作系統(OS)。操作系統是一款用于管理軟硬件資源的軟件。 操作系統的組成包括: 內核(負責進程管理、內存管理、驅動管理...
java中main返回值類型 main方法返回值類型void的含義
java中main方法的返回值類型通常是void,因為它不返回任何值給調用者。1) void表示main方法不返回值,符合java設計哲學,專注于程序邏輯。2) 某些情況下,main方法可返回int,用于特殊場景如嵌...